About SkillNet Solutions SkillNet Solutions is a global technology consulting firm delivering eCommerce, order management, point-of-sale, and digital commerce implementations for retail and consumer brands. Our Client Engagement division partners with clients from initial discovery through go-live and beyond, blending onshore and offshore delivery talent to execute complex, multi-workstream retail technology programs.

The Role We're looking for an Engagement Manager to join our EMEA team and own the client relationship and delivery oversight for a portfolio of retail technology engagements, with particular emphasis on Oracle Retail Xstore point-of-sale implementations, upgrades, and cutover programs. You'll sit at the intersection of client leadership, project delivery, and SkillNet's commercial goals — running steering committees, managing scope and financials, and keeping cross-functional teams (PMs, BAs, architects, developers, onshore and offshore) aligned and accountable.

You'll join a peer group of Engagement Managers reporting directly to the VP of Client Engagement, working alongside Strategic Consulting and Global Presales colleagues across SkillNet's matrix organization.

What You'll Do

  • Serve as the primary client-facing owner for assigned EMEA retail accounts, building and nurturing trusted relationships with client sponsors and stakeholders.
  • Lead client steering committees and executive status reviews, preparing pre-reads, tracking actions, and driving decisions to closure.
  • Manage the full engagement lifecycle for Oracle Retail Xstore point-of-sale programs — including version upgrades, new-store rollouts, and cutover/go-live planning — in partnership with Project Managers and technical leads.
  • Own engagement financials: track budget, margin, and consultant utilization against targets, and course-correct when indicators signal risk.
  • Develop and negotiate Statements of Work (SOWs) and Change Requests (CRs), coordinating estimates and scope with delivery and offshore leadership.
  • Coordinate resourcing and hard-booking requests across onshore and offshore, multi-vendor delivery teams, ensuring the right skills are in place at the right time.
  • Manage risks, issues, and escalations throughout delivery, maintaining RAID logs and driving mitigation with project leadership.
  • Identify opportunities to expand SkillNet's footprint within existing accounts, working closely with sales and presales colleagues.
  • Ensure engagements follow SkillNet delivery standards, templates, and governance processes across waterfall, agile, and hybrid delivery models.
  • Provide regular reporting to SkillNet leadership on account health, financials, and delivery status.

What You'll Bring

  • 9+ years of experience in IT consulting, professional services, or systems integration, with meaningful exposure to eCommerce or retail technology programs.
  • Hands-on experience with Oracle Retail Xstore or a comparable retail point-of-sale / store commerce platform strongly preferred; familiarity with order management, ERP, or pricing/inventory systems is a plus.
  • Demonstrated experience owning client relationships and running steering committees or equivalent executive governance forums.
  • Experience managing engagement financials — budget, margin, and utilization — and reporting on program KPIs.
  • Track record developing SOWs, CRs, and project plans, and negotiating scope, deliverables, and terms with clients.
  • Experience coordinating onshore-offshore, multi-vendor delivery teams across time zones.
  • Comfortable operating across waterfall, agile, and hybrid delivery methodologies.
  • Strong executive presence and communication skills, with the ability to manage senior stakeholders and navigate ambiguity.
  • Based in the UK and able to travel to client sites across the UK/EMEA as needed.

Nice to Have

  • Prior experience on Xstore upgrade or cutover/go-live programs specifically (e.g., version upgrades, big-bang go-lives).
  • Familiarity with adjacent Oracle Retail modules (ORCE, RMS) or other retail commerce platforms.
  • PMP, PRINCE2, or equivalent project/program management certification.
  • Experience working within a matrixed consulting organization spanning Client Management, Strategic Consulting, and Presales functions.

Education

  • Degree in Information Technology, Business, Engineering, or a related field; equivalent experience will be considered.
